• EOS (https://eos.io): EOS ICO happened in 2017. EOS cryptocur-
rency tokens were sold by a blockchain architecture start-up called
Block.one. ICO raised about $185m in just 5 days. The initial token
price was $0.925 and climbed to $5 within a few days after release.
Over the years since the ICO launch, EOS has gone as high as $22.89.
EOS claims to be a competitor to the Ethereum network by provid-
ing application developers with a comprehensive ecosystem compris-
ing of databases, account permissions, scheduling, authentication and
internet application communication tools.
• NXT (https://nxt-token.com/en/accueil-next-token-nxt-english): NXT
went through ICO in 2013 at an initial token price of $0.0000168. It
was one of the earliest ICO and NXT was one of the most success-
ful ICOs with one token selling for just $0.0000168 and raising about
$16,800 worth of Bitcoins at that time. The project used the funds to
develop a digital currency platform and also designed its proprietary
open-source consensus mechanism. NXT was trading at as high as
USD 2.16 around late 2017.
• ARK (https://ark.io): ARK ICO happened in 2016 with an initial
token price of $0.04. Ark’s goal was to create a decentralised digital
currency platform that allows for the quick integration of other cryp-
tocurrencies into its own blockchain. ARK ICO was successful and
returned over 35,000% ROI to investors when its token price climbed
to about $11.00 in late 2017.
• LISK (https://lisk.com): Lisk ICO happened in mid-2016 with an ini-
tial token price of $0.076 and raised about 14,000 Bitcoins worth
about $6m at the time. Lisk hit a long-time high of $39.15 provid-
ing an ROI of over 19,000% to investors, who purchased tokens at
the time of its ICO. Lisk was the first modular blockchain platform
enabling developers to create blockchain apps with Javascript and
operate these apps on side chains.
• Particl (https://particl.io): Particl ICO was launched in March 2017
with an initial token price of $1.50. It created a ROI of about 3,495%.
Particl token went as high as $52.40 around 2018; however, it is trad-
ing at $1.65 now. Particl was designed to offer total privacy to its
users. It offers cryptocurrency and a decentralised marketplace can-
tered on anonymous transactions to offer its users total anonymity.
